| Running a successful company combines qualified employees and an effective, active management team. A constructive management style allows employees to participate in the process of optimising the company’s achievements. They follow the aim of the collective organisation and assure a competitive position within the market. ‘Investors in People’ is a European standard in which companies are recognised for their achievements in applying processes to the way they work. Since December 2007 WILA Lichttechnik GmbH has been accredited with IIP recognition.
IIP originates in the UK; created as a project by the British Government in 1993, today IIP is a tool for human resource development all over Europe. “Our organisation in the UK has held this accreditation since 1997” reports Andreas Henrich, CEO WILA Lichttechnik GmbH. “IIP is not as well known in this country as for example the ISO 9000 quality standard, and as one of the first companies in Germany to receive IIP accreditation, we have used this standard to aid us in continuously advancing and improving our business. Simultaneously we clarify the high European level and establish a border between us and markets with poor labour conditions.” The IIP certification has been granted for a period of 3 years, after which time the company will once again undergo a vigorous testing period.
Transparent Processes
When WILA was taken over by its current shareholders in 2005 the management style changed. “In the past the different departments did not know much about the operation area of others”, says Henrich “Today all processes show a high degree of transparency.” Employees will be informed about the company’s current situation and the ongoing development on a regular basis. Furthermore the business plan is accessible for every member of the company.
“WILA stands for Service, Quality and Innovation. We can keep this benchmark because our employees will always be further educated and trained.” says the CEO. During the IIP accreditation process the company developed a Human Resource Development plan which included individual training for every employee – orientated along the company aims. Thereby WILA analysed among other things the benefits of further education.
Regular Communication
Regular communication is important. The management team meets every second week, departmental meetings are held once a month and the company meets as a whole every quarter. Employees are encouraged to participate in company decisions and to come forward with new ideas for improvement. 12 employees, who act independent from the management team, supervise an IIP-forum to implement and communicate wishes, meanings and initiatives from colleagues.
